Comfortable but wears out quickly

I doubt these grips. The wearing comfort is excellent. The style is nice and clean. However, they do not stand up to everyday use. I had them on my Ninja 1000 for about a year and had to replace them due to wear and tear. If they were a little more durable, it would easily be 5 stars. At least they're cheap.

Perfect grip with a shorter service life.

Bought these for my 1299 Panigale S. I think they are standard on the Superleggera. Great grips, 1000 times better comfort than original Ducati grips. The only downside is that they wear out quickly. Driven 7000 km, change soon. However, for the low price, it's worth it.

Cheap but noticeable aesthetic upgrade

I love these pens. Other people mention using hairspray as a lube; I can't imagine that with my bike. Use highly concentrated medical alcohol as a lubricant. Friction is enough to keep them tight and they're perfect once the alcohol has evaporated. In my experience it is not necessary to use glue. I've ridden a dozen times since I put them on and they never slip.
